Understanding Trading Fees
Before diving into specific exchanges, it's essential to understand the types of fees you may encounter:
Trading Fees: A fee applied to each trade, typically revealed as a portion of the trade amount.Withdrawal Fees: Fees credited withdraw funds from the exchange to your checking account or crypto wallet.Deposit Fees: Fees associated with transferring funds into the trading platform, normally applicable only to fiat deals.
It's essential to take a look at all these fees when considering a cryptocurrency exchange, as they can add up in time, eating into your profits.

Q5: What is a maker and taker fee?

A5: The 'maker' fee applies to traders who add liquidity to the order book (positioning a limitation order), while the 'taker' fee uses to those who take liquidity from the book (putting a market order).
